Please Note
WGS 84 = GDA94 service
This dataset has a spatial reference of [WGS 84 = GDA94] and can NOT be easily consumed into GDA2020 environments. A similar service with a ‘multiCRS’ suffix is available which can support GDA2020, GDA94 and WGS84 = GDA2020 environments. In due course, and allowing time for user feedback and testing, it is intended that these original services will adopt the new multiCRS functionally.
A wire used for the
transmission of electricity rated at 19.13kv through to 500kv. This line
feature dataset is part of Spatial Services
Defined Administrative Data Sets Where possible, line
geometries of the electricity transmission line dataset align to Spatial Services Defined Administrative Data Sets.

Upon receiving a supply of
data or notification of change from Spatial Services - Administrative Spatial
Program and Geoscience Australia, Spatial
Services Defined Administrative Data is updated to reflect the
information provided by the contributor in a spatial context. This will include
but not be limited to, the addition or removal of electricity transmission
lines to the Features of Interest Category and changes to the spatial position
or name of an electricity transmission line.

Accuracy
The dataset maintains a positional relationship to, and alignment with, a range of themes from the NSW FSDF including, transport, imagery, positioning, water and land cover. This dataset was captured by digitising the best available cadastral mapping at a variety of scales and accuracies, ranging from 1:500 to 1:250 000 according to the National Mapping Council of Australia, Standards of Map Accuracy (1975). Therefore, the position of the feature instance will be within 0.5mm at map scale for 90% of the well-defined points. That is, 1:500 = 0.25m, 1:2000 = 1m, 1:4000 = 2m, 1:25000 = 12.5m, 1:50000 = 25m and 1:100000 = 50m. A program of positional upgrade (accuracy improvement) is currently underway.
